The System Economy as well as the Increase of Inventor Money Making

OnlyFans operates on a simple premise: makers publish information behind a paywall, and also users pay month-to-month fees, suggestions, or pay-per-view charges to access it. The platform maintains a portion of earnings, while producers maintain the bulk. This style has permitted many people to bypass conventional gatekeepers in home entertainment and also monetize directly from viewers. compare the overview

Nonetheless, unlike conventional labor markets where earnings are reasonably standardized, revenues on OnlyFans are strongly jagged. Earnings circulation adheres to a “electrical power rule,” where a small portion of developers make most of income. Sex Structure of Producers

Throughout several market studies, girls stand for the majority of designers on OnlyFans. Estimations coming from influencer market research companies and producer economic climate files generally recommend that women developers compose a sizable a large number of accounts, typically mentioned in the variety of two-thirds to three-quarters of all customers. Male comprise a smaller sized symmetry, though their presence has been actually continuously boosting, specifically in niches including exercise coaching, way of living content, and also male grown-up home entertainment.

This discrepancy is actually notable because it molds both source and also competition. With even more women producers in the ecosystem, competitors one of ladies is actually higher, specifically in saturated groups like appeal web content as well as grown-up membership solutions. Concurrently, need from subscribers– that are mainly male– produces various monetization dynamics across sexes.

Revenues Distribution: Females, Male, as well as System Disparity

When analyzing profits, it is important to compare average (mean) profit and also mean earnings. On platforms like OnlyFans, the way is actually highly manipulated by best earners, while the average producer gets reasonably moderate amounts.

Numerous sector reports, including evaluations presented by platforms such as Statista and also maker economic condition analysis organizations, indicate that:

A very tiny percent of designers earn six-figure or perhaps seven-figure yearly earnings.
The majority of producers earn under a handful of hundred dollars per month.
Earnings inequality is extreme, along with leading 1– 5% recording a significant share of overall revenue.
Female Producers

Women makers dominate high-earning visibility on the system, especially in adult material groups. This is to some extent as a result of demand characteristics: heterosexual male subscribers embody a huge individual foundation able to spend for exclusive web content. Because of this, a lot of the system’s openly realized best income earners are actually women.

However, this does not mean the common female producer makes greater than male inventors. Actually, because of high competition one of ladies, a lot of women creators struggle to create lasting customer manners unless they obtain sturdy marketing, niche distinction, or even external social networks followings.

Male Makers

Male makers are far fewer in number yet frequently work in less saturated niche markets. Health and fitness training, monetary insight, and way of living advertising have a tendency to be more typical among male accounts. In many cases, male producers experience higher sale costs in particular niche target markets due to lesser competition and also more targeted advertising techniques.

Fascinatingly, some evaluations recommend that while fewer guys connect with the complete top of incomes rankings, a part of male creators may achieve strong average efficiency relative to their women versions in details particular niches. Nevertheless, these results differ extensively depending on dataset limitations as well as testing prejudice.

The Job of Particular Niche as well as Viewers Habits

Gender-based earnings distinctions can not be actually entirely recognized without thinking about material classification. On OnlyFans, grown-up content remains the leading earnings driver, and gender plays a solid duty in individual taste. Female designers in grown-up categories usually gain from higher requirement, however additionally experience intense competition as well as commodification tensions.

Male producers, alternatively, often count less on grown-up information and also more on personality-driven branding. This may cause more stable however slower development trajectories. For instance, health and fitness influencers may create long-term user manners along with lesser churn costs reviewed to adult web content developers, whose target markets might fluctuate a lot more swiftly.

Viewers demographics likewise matter. Customers are actually primarily male, which determines costs energy and requirement for female designers’ information. However, as LGBTQ+ readers and female users increase, the platform’s gender mechanics are actually progressively branching out.

Platform Protocols as well as Visibility Predisposition

Yet another crucial element affecting profits is presence. Like the majority of electronic systems, OnlyFans performs certainly not function in isolation; producers typically rely on exterior platforms such as Instagram, TikTok, or X (formerly Twitter) to drive traffic.

This produces a second level of inequality: makers along with more powerful social media followings– despite sex– are very likely to accomplish high incomes. Nevertheless, gendered engagement patterns on social networks can easily boost differences. Women designers often acquire higher interaction prices but likewise encounter higher pestering as well as material examination, which may affect long-lasting sustainability.

Economic Analysis: Exists a Sex Spend Void on OnlyFans?

Unlike traditional work markets, OnlyFans does certainly not have actually repaired earnings, so the principle of a “wages gap” is actually not directly applicable similarly. As an alternative, what exists is an “revenues distribution gap” influenced through:

Producer source by gender
Audience need by content type
System visibility and also mathematical promo
Exterior advertising range
Niche market concentration

Hence, while females control both the system as well as numerous top-earning jobs, this performs not always translate into greater common earnings all over all women inventors. Rather, it shows a strongly unequal market where results is actually focused one of a handful of individuals.
